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om the 19119 ZIP Code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in 19119 with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in 19119 is at Black Feather Apartments listed at $1,194.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om 19119 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in 19119 is $1,865.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om 19119 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in 19119 is a 1,366 square feet unit starting from $1,889 at SouthBridge Townhomes.
